My name is Oscar. I am Canadian and was born in Ottawa, Ontario however, my family originally is from India and Scotland. I have lived in Ottawa my whole life. I am a student at St.Philips Catholic School and I am 11 years old. I really enjoy living in this area in the winter because there’s always so much snow to play in, but the summer is fun too! 



I have channeled my love of the snow into a beautiful painting using acrylic paint and brushes depicting a snowy area here in Ottawa. A professional artist named Katerina Mertikas taught me and my class how to make this type of painting. I created this painting because our class has been investigating what it means to feel joy and how joy affects our lives so I just thought back to the fluffy white snow here in Ottawa and knew what my painting would look like. I have always been fascinated by how art can so easily wash away the bad in your day and paint good on top. In my painting I used color to separate the different parts of my painting and to create composition. Through the artistic process, I realized that anyone can make art and that no matter how bad your art looks it’s still the only one in the world that looks like it so you should always think of your art as priceless. I remember when I was younger kids said that my art didn’t look good because it wasn't perfect but when I came home that day with that art in my hands my parents were amazed because they understood how much work I had put into it. I hope that when people see my art they take on my parents' mindset and think about how I put lots of work into it, and that it’s one of a kind.



To me, my art is very special because I know how much work I put into it and how many memories I created with my friends and classmates during this experience. I am only challenged by the fact that I don’t paint very often so if I made it a hobby I would have to make a lot of paintings before they started looking anything like Katerina Mertikas’s paintings however, I hope that this piece of art will encourage me to paint more and more and create new beautiful paintings.
